How to Find & Negotiate with the Right Speaker for Your Event

Presenter: Jeff Davidson, MBA, CMC

View On Demand

Would you like to have some strategies that make it easier to find the right speaker for your event, and to negotiate with that speaker to reach a favorable agreement that represents a win-win? If so, this session is for you. Veteran speaker Jeff Davidson, who has delivered 965 presentations across 46 states, eight countries and 21 cruises (it’s a tough job, but somebody’s got to do it), is going highlight:

  • Eight basic ways to find the right speaker
  • Eight ways to know that the speaker you have identified will be easy to work with and will please your audience members
  • More than 30 negotiation strategies so that both you and the speaker can come to agreement

The great news is that virtually everything Jeff will discuss is within your grasp and can be put to use right away. This is a session you will not want to miss.
